Why Incorporate in Delaware?

Delaware’s reputation as a corporate haven is well-earned. The state offers several advantages for startups:

  • Business-Friendly Laws: Delaware’s General Corporation Law is one of the most advanced and flexible in the United States, providing clear guidelines and protections for businesses.
  • Legal Expertise: The Court of Chancery specializes in corporate law, ensuring that legal disputes are handled efficiently and knowledgeably.
  • Investor Appeal: Many investors prefer Delaware corporations due to their familiarity with the state’s corporate laws and the ease of conducting transactions.

Choosing Between C Corporation and LLC

When it comes to Delaware startup incorporation, the two most popular structures are C Corporations and Limited Liability Companies (LLCs). Each has its own set of advantages and disadvantages.

C Corporation

Advantages:
Easier to Raise Capital: C Corps can issue multiple classes of stock, making it easier to attract investors and venture capital.
Stock Options: Offering stock options can be a powerful tool for attracting and retaining top talent.
Investor Familiarity: Investors are more accustomed to the C Corp structure, which can facilitate funding rounds.

Disadvantages:
Double Taxation: C Corps are subject to corporate income tax, and shareholders are also taxed on dividends, leading to double taxation.
More Regulatory Requirements: C Corps must adhere to stringent reporting and compliance standards, which can be time-consuming and costly.

Limited Liability Company (LLC)

Advantages:
Flexible Management Structure: LLCs offer more flexibility in management and operational structures compared to C Corps.
Pass-Through Taxation: Profits and losses can be passed directly to owners, avoiding the double taxation inherent in C Corps.
Less Compliance: LLCs face fewer regulatory requirements, reducing administrative burdens.

Disadvantages:
Investor Reluctance: Some investors may prefer C Corps, making it potentially harder to raise capital.
Limited Stock Options: LLCs cannot issue stock, which may limit options for employee compensation and investment.
